共 3 篇文章
标签:万网虚拟主机发邮件教程:轻松上手,高效稳定! (万网虚拟主机发邮件)
VPS安装AMH教程:轻松搭建高效的网站环境,在当今数字化时代,拥有一个高效且稳定的网站环境对于个人和企业来说至关重要,虚拟私人服务器(VPS)提供了一种灵活、可自定义的解决方案,而AMH是一款流行的、易于使用的Linux服务器管理面板,能够帮助用户快速搭建和管理网站环境,本教程将详细指导您如何在VPS上安装AMH,并确保您的网站运行得既高效又安全。, ,准备工作,在开始之前,请确保您已经购买了VPS,并且具有以下基本信息:,1、VPS的IP地址,2、服务器的root账号和密码,3、服务器的系统版本(推荐CentOS 6/7或Ubuntu 14/16/18),第一步:登录服务器,通过SSH客户端(如PuTTY或SecureCRT)使用root账号登录到您的VPS。,第二步:更新系统,在安装AMH之前,先对系统进行更新,以确保所有软件包都是最新的,根据您服务器的操作系统,执行以下命令:,CentOS系统:,“`,yum update y,“`,Ubuntu系统:, ,“`,aptget update && aptget upgrade y,“`,第三步:安装AMH,AMH支持多种安装方式,这里我们使用官方推荐的脚本安装方法,执行以下命令下载并安装AMH:,该命令将会下载AMH安装脚本,赋予执行权限,然后运行安装脚本,安装过程会显示在屏幕上,同时日志会被保存到 amh.log文件中。,第四步:配置AMH,安装完成后,根据提示输入您的选择来配置AMH,您可以设置AMH的端口、选择要安装的软件版本等,如果您不确定,可以直接按回车键选择默认选项。,第五步:访问AMH控制面板,配置完成后,您将获得AMH控制面板的访问地址、端口和初始密码,使用浏览器访问该地址,输入用户名(默认为admin)和初始密码,登录AMH控制面板。,第六步:创建站点,登录后,您可以在AMH控制面板中轻松创建和管理站点,点击“创建站点”按钮,填写域名、选择网站根目录、设置数据库等,然后点击“提交”按钮创建站点。,第七步:配置DNS解析,为了使您的网站能够被访问,您需要在域名注册商处将域名的DNS解析设置为您VPS的IP地址。, ,第八步:上传网站文件,通过FTP客户端或者Web文件管理器,将您的网站文件上传到站点的根目录中。,第九步:测试网站,打开浏览器输入您的域名,检查网站是否正常运行。,相关问题与解答, Q1: 如何卸载AMH?,A1: 您可以通过运行AMH提供的卸载命令来卸载AMH,具体命令可以在AMH官方文档中找到。, Q2: AMH是否支持Windows服务器?,A2: 不支持,AMH仅支持基于Linux的操作系统。, Q3: 我可以在AMH中安装多个版本的PHP吗?,A3: 可以,AMH支持多版本PHP并行安装,您可以根据需要选择不同的PHP版本。, Q4: 如果我忘记了AMH的登录密码怎么办?,A4: 您可以通过SSH登录到服务器,然后使用AMH提供的命令重置密码,具体命令可以参考AMH官方文档。,VPS Avenger是一款免费的Windows VPS(虚拟专用服务器)管理软件。安装过程如下:,,1. 下载VPS Avenger安装包。,2. 双击运行安装程序。,3. 按照提示完成安装。,4. 启动软件并输入VPS信息。,5. 连接并管理您的VPS。,wget http://amh.sh/amh.sh && chmod 775 amh.sh && ./amh.sh 2>&1 | tee amh.log,
HTML权限设置主要是通过HTTP响应头来实现的,HTTP响应头包含了关于服务器、请求的内容,以及可能的其他相关信息,与HTML权限相关的主要有ContentType和ContentSecurityPolicy两个响应头。,1、ContentType响应头,ContentType响应头用于告诉浏览器返回的内容是什么类型的,如果返回的是HTML文档,那么ContentType的值就是”text/html”,这个响应头对于HTML权限的设置非常重要,因为它决定了浏览器如何解析返回的内容。,在服务器端,你可以通过设置ContentType响应头来指定返回的内容类型,如果你想要返回一个HTML文档,你可以这样设置:,在这个例子中,我们使用了Flask框架来创建一个Web应用,当用户访问主页时,服务器会返回一个包含”Hello, World!”标题的HTML文档,我们通过设置ContentType响应头为”text/html”来告诉浏览器这是一个HTML文档。,2、ContentSecurityPolicy响应头,ContentSecurityPolicy(CSP)是一个HTTP响应头,用于帮助检测和缓解某些类型的攻击,包括跨站脚本(XSS)和数据注入攻击等,CSP可以限制浏览器只加载和执行来自特定来源的脚本,从而保护网站的安全。,在服务器端,你可以通过设置ContentSecurityPolicy响应头来指定CSP策略,如果你想要禁止所有外部脚本的执行,你可以这样设置:,在这个例子中,我们设置了CSP策略为”defaultsrc ‘self’”,这意味着只允许从当前源加载脚本,任何来自外部源的脚本都将被阻止执行。,3、使用HTTPS保护HTML内容,除了设置ContentType和ContentSecurityPolicy响应头外,你还应该使用HTTPS来保护你的HTML内容,HTTPS是一种安全的HTTP协议,它可以加密客户端和服务器之间的通信,防止中间人攻击。,在服务器端,你需要为你的网站配置SSL证书,这通常涉及到购买一个SSL证书,然后在服务器上安装和配置它,具体的步骤取决于你使用的服务器软件和操作系统。,HTML权限设置主要是通过设置HTTP响应头来实现的,ContentType响应头用于告诉浏览器返回的内容是什么类型的,而ContentSecurityPolicy响应头用于帮助检测和缓解某些类型的攻击,你还应该使用HTTPS来保护你的HTML内容。, ,from flask import Flask, make_response app = Flask(__name__) @app.route(‘/’) def home(): response = make_response(“<h1>Hello, World!</h1>”) response.headers[‘ContentType’] = ‘text/html’ return response,from flask import Flask, make_response app = Flask(__name__) @app.route(‘/’) def home(): response = make_response(“<h1>Hello, World!</h1>”) response.headers[‘ContentSecurityPolicy’] = “defaultsrc ‘self'” return response,